Output 3f3c62fa2b947712d6bb3fd4d0ffe7b9c498978e6e30efc6f23e981c432bf06a:0

value
12168935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d4f157c35622e23a94584c93433cb7a17836c9 OP_EQUAL
address
3G5Z7BY4UrMZqntR2PiKnCNhMaPTQGdFjZ
transaction
3f3c62fa2b947712d6bb3fd4d0ffe7b9c498978e6e30efc6f23e981c432bf06a
confirmations
451010
spent
true